Steering Gear And Linkage: Assembly

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2009 Nissan Maxima.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Apply Three Bond 1111B or equivalent to inner socket and turn pinion fully to retract inner socket into gear housing assembly.
  2. Install large end (1) of boot (2) to gear housing assembly.
  3. Install small end (3) of boot (2) to inner socket boot mounting groove.

  4. Install boot clamp to boot small end.
  5. Install boot clamp to boot large end using Tool.

    CAUTION: Do not reuse boot clamps.

    Tool number: KV40107300 (-) 

  6. Adjust inner socket to standard length (L), and then tighten lock nut to the specified torque. Check length of inner socket (L) again after tightening lock nut. Make sure that the length is the standard.

Inner socket length (L): Refer to  "STEERING GEAR "

CAUTION: Adjust toe-in after this procedure. The length achieved after toe-in adjustment is not necessarily the above value.
